1. Matches are numbered.
Play will be continuous. As soon as one match is finished, the next
match will start. Players will be defaulted if they are not ready to
play within 5 minutes after the match is called. 2. During all matches,
players are to remain on the court. If an emergency arises, the players
will go to the back of the court and raise their racket. 3. Only players and
officials are permitted on the court s during competition. 4. There is a 90 second
break between the first and second game of every match with coaching
allowed. The coaching must be done on the court (the coach must come
onto the court to the player). The 5 minute break with coaching between
a second and third game of a match remains in force. 5. For split sets,
there will be a five minute time allotment. A player may leave the court
during this time and confer with their coach. Players, parents, or
coaches may not coach other players during the match. 6. After a match,
winners must promptly return used shuttles and score sheets to the head
table. 7. Warm-up is limited
to 5 minutes. 8. Substitution may
take place up to the players' first match provided the substitute player
has not been placed in another position within the tournament. 9. The East Valley
Region Tournament will qualify the four singles and four doubles teams
for the state tournament. 10. Awards: A 5A East
Valley Region Championship Team Trophy will be presented to the team
with the best record in region play. 11. All players should
arrive at the tournament in uniform, locker room facilities will be
provided if needed. 12. Unsportsmanlike
conduct will not be tolerated on the courts. Use of profanity on the
court, or verbal intimidation toward an opponent will result in disqualification
and forfeiture of the match. 13. For seeding meeting
purposes, season record is to be compiled only from matches against
East Valley opponents at the designated position (i.e.. record at #1
position). If you played an East Valley Region opponent on more than
one occasion, only the last meeting will count. Please copy the attached
information sheet for seeding and bring one completed sheet for each
of your four entries to the seeding meeting. If this form is not completed,
your entries will not be seeded. 14. All schools
must fill out the Regional Entry Sheet which will accompany any seeding
sheets you also wish to enter.
